  • Bourbon virus (BRBV), RNA virus, single strand, negative-sense member of Thogotovirus genus, Orthomyxoviridae family
    • Most closely related known viruses: Dhori virus (seen in ticks, mosquitoes and lethal in mice; cases in humans rare but can cause fever or encephalitis), Batken virus (sub-type of Dhori virus)
    • Discovered in 2014 and named for Bourbon County, Kansas
